Frequently Asked Questions
- What is a strategy report card?
- A comprehensive analysis of your trading strategy: Monte Carlo, walk-forward, deflated Sharpe, robustness score, equity curve, and all risk metrics. It tells you if your strategy is real or overfit.
- What is Monte Carlo analysis?
- We resample your trade returns 400 times to simulate different orderings. This shows the range of possible outcomes and the probability of loss.
- What is walk-forward analysis?
- We split your backtest into rolling windows and check if the strategy is profitable in each. If edge only appears in one window, it's not robust.
